Stone step repair services involve restoring and stabilizing outdoor stone steps that have become damaged or unsafe over time. This process typically includes fixing cracks, chips, or uneven surfaces, as well as addressing issues like loose or sinking stones.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to carefully repair and reinforce the existing stone, helping to restore both the appearance and safety of the steps. Proper repair not only improves the visual appeal of a property’s entrance but also helps prevent accidents caused by unstable or deteriorated steps.
Many common problems can be addressed through stone step repair.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and freezing temperatures can cause stones to crack, shift, or settle unevenly. Additionally, heavy foot traffic or improper installation may lead to loose or cracked stones. Property owners often seek repair services when noticing uneven surfaces, cracks that widen, or loose stones that pose tripping hazards. Repairing these issues can extend the lifespan of the steps and maintain the overall safety and aesthetic of the property’s entryway.

The overview below groups typical Stone Step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woburn,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250-$600 for minor stone step repairs such as filling cracks or replacing individual stones.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- more extensive fixes, including rebuilding or replacing multiple steps, generally cost between $600-$1,500. Larger projects with additional structural work can push costs into this range, though fewer projects reach the upper end.
Full Replacement - replacing an entire set of stone steps often costs from $1,500-$3,500, depending on the size and complexity. Many full replacements stay within this range, with very large or intricate projects potentially exceeding it.
Larger, Complex Projects - extensive repairs or custom installations can reach $3,500 or more, especially when involving detailed craftsmanship or additional structural modifications. Such projects are less common but can significantly increase costs based on scope and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Stone step repair services are commonly needed when property owners in Woburn, MA notice cracks, uneven surfaces, or loose stones in their walkways, patios, or garden paths. These issues can occur over time due to regular foot traffic, weather exposure, or settling of the ground beneath. When stone steps become cracked or unstable, they can pose safety risks or detract from the overall appearance of the property, prompting owners to seek professional repair solutions to restore both safety and curb appeal.
Additionally, property owners may look for stone step repair services after experiencing damage from harsh winter conditions or heavy snowfall common in the Woburn area. Shifting frost, ice, and snow can cause stones to shift or crack, leading to uneven surfaces or potential tripping hazards.
